July 16 Webinar: Twitter and Twitter Apps for Nonprofits

Nonprofit Tech for Good

Date: Tuesday, July 16, 2013. View: All Webinars for Nonprofits. This webinar begins with a general introduction to Twitter and then quickly moves on to demonstrate how nonprofits can use the site to increase their supporter base, website traffic, e-newsletter subscribers, online donors, and overall visibility on the Internet.
